Vibration control and BBS system

The BBS system is based on a set of precisely interacting elements: a height-adjustable steel cone, an intermediate carbon polymer element, and steel sockets embedded in the shelves.

Point contact between the cone and the intermediate element stabilizes the structure while allowing controlled pendular motion. At the next stage, limited rolling and sliding motion occurs between the intermediate element and the socket embedded in the shelf.

This sequence prevents linear transmission of vibrations and enables their gradual dissipation through friction, rolling resistance, and internal material damping.

The system combines the advantages of minimal contact area (energy dispersion) with effective damping of transverse and oblique vibrations.

The BBS system is protected by patent UPRP P.404137.

TECHNICAL DESCRIPTION

Overall height: 790 mm;
Overall width: 730mm;
Overall depth: 740 mm;
Leg profile: 120 x 120 mm;
Top shelf: 670 x 680 x 30 + 30 mm;
Center and bottom shelves: 530 x 580 x 30 + 30 mm;
Usable distance between the shelves (moving upwards): 230, 230 mm;
Maximum load for each shelf: up to 80 kg (total: 240 kg)

The Balancing Board System

The reference kinematic anti-vibration Balancing Board System BBS (Patent P.404137) is used in the construction of models marked with the abbreviation BBS. The system consists of a threaded, height-adjustable spike made of high-fiber-content steel alloy, on top of which two elements are placed, each with an inner bearing. An intermediary (middle) element is made of carbon fiber and supports another element, a steel bearing inserted into the shelf. Point contact between the steel spike and the carbon intermediary element prevents movement of either element relative to its axis, but it allows pendular motion. Meanwhile, the contact between the intermediary element and the bearing inserted into the shelf allows restricted rolling motion and sliding motion. Consequently, the advantages of spike point support (contact area has been minimized and kinetic energy turns into heat) have been combined with the effects of deadening vibrations owing to to sliding friction and rolling resistance.
